What color is A86B75?

The RGB color code for color number #A86B75 is RGB(168, 107, 117). In the RGB color model, #A86B75 has a red value of 168, a green value of 107, and a blue value of 117.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 0.0% cyan, 36.3% magenta, 30.4% yellow, and 34.1%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 350.2° (degrees), 26.0 % saturation, and 53.9 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#A86B75 has a hue of 350.2° (degrees), 36.3 % saturation and 65.9 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of A86B75?

Color code A86B75 has an LRV of nearly 20. By LRV value, it is a medium dark color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.

Triadic Color Palette

The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el

Tetradic Color Palette

The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
